Choosing the Game Type
The first step was to decide what kind of game did i want to make. An RTS? an FPS? a Graphical Adventure? a Puzzle? etc…
I was between two options:
- A nice point-and-click graphical adventure but in 3D.
- An RTS game like ‘Settlers II’
A graphical adventure is easier. It doesn't require any kind of crazy AI. As a developer you have a lot of control about what the player is doing and can do.
It requires a lot details in the scenes and a well thought game flow.
An RTS is harder. You have buildings, units, camera control, AI, a good GUI is important. It has a lot of behaviors and stuff.
